The BAH floor. Joint Base San Antonio rotates tens of thousands of personnel with housing allowances that put a published floor under area rents. Few rental markets anywhere offer that kind of legible demand.
The target zones. Converse, Universal City, Schertz, and the Northeast side around Randolph, plus the Lackland orbit on the West Side. Three-bedroom homes at allowance-friendly rents stay occupied essentially permanently.
Operating for the tenant base. Military tenants move on orders: expect turnover, write leases accordingly, and keep make-ready fast. In exchange you get reliable payment and a fresh tenant pool every season. It is the fairest trade in landlording.
